Nancy Anne Carroll (Doughty)
Nancy Anne Carroll of Holland, PA died peacefully on Wednesday September 22, 2021 at her residence at Holland Village. She was 90 years young.
Born in Pittsburgh, Nancy was the beloved wife of the late Thomas W. Carroll, who died in 1997. Daughter of the late Albert and Catherine (Chambers) Doughty of Pittsburgh, PA.
Nancy Anne was a graduate of Crafton High School where she played basketball. Her professional career spanned many years in the insurance industry, having worked for Richard Hardenberg Insurance, Group of Marlton, NJ and retired from Cigna Insurance Co. Phila, as an Executive Manager. She was a very talented seamstress, making draperies and clothing for friends and family. She found particular joy in making doll clothes, needlework and crafts for her grandchildren. She was admired for her strong work ethic and resourcefulness.
She formerly lived in Merchantville NJ, Bensalem, Philadelphia and Leesburg FL. She and Tom took great pleasure in residing on historic Elfreth’s Alley in Philadelphia and participating in the annual Fete Day celebrations. Nancy and Tom loved to travel and fulfilled their retirement dream of being full time motor homers traveling the United States and Canada. During these cross-country trips, they enjoyed meeting new friends and sharing experiences with numerous motor home clubs. After the death of her husband, she was blessed with the love of her dear companion Dale Fulmer, who was her partner for over 15 years until his death.
Nancy returned to Bucks County in 2017, moving to Holland Village to be closer to her family. There she found new friends and enjoyed the friendly rivalry of being a loyal Pittsburgh Steelers fan among her new Philadelphia Eagles fan community. She valued the dedicated support staff of Holland Village that helped her enjoy each day.
Nancy Anne is survived by her daughter Patricia (Carroll) Haneman and her husband Niel of Washington Crossing, PA and her 3 devoted grandchildren; Colin, Chelsea and Kylee Haneman. She was predeceased by her sister Jean Haffner (Doughty) and brother Donald Doughty.
